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10937 4368 920475446
369244435 147854 12590317916
369244435 147854 12590317916
12448 3013271 456831417 5810 900
All about undefined
Interested in learning more?
369244435 147854 12590317916
12448 3013271 456831417 5810 900
See more
918821 52647591 5241
29874 17 84
See more
110217490 3447017
3393296344 35507711 951
See more